Whirlpool gas dryer troubleshooting
 
Dryer is a Whirlpool GGQ9800LW1, about 20 years old. The belt broke, but the motor is also not spinning when it's turned on. No 60 hz hum either, and the armature spins freely when turned by hand.

The thermal fuse has continuity, and the door switch is fine -- turns on the light, and you can hear a relay click inside the control panel when you move the switch.

Where do I start troubleshooting? I can get parts diagram online, but not a circuit diagram, apparently.

Thanks - fixed it. New belt did it -- there was a switch in the tensioner arm that shut the motor off if the belt broke.
